Leah's story

Leah is 36 years old, married, and blessed with two child under eighteen years old. She has a retail shop business, which she has been operating for 10 years. She makes a monthly income of 400,000 KES.

She is applying for her first loan cycle of 100,000 KES from VisionFund Kenya and plans to use the loan amount to buy mattresses, sufurias, and basins to sell. She anticipates using the profits made from the business to pay loans and add more stock to her business. In the future, she hopes to open to expand her business and educate her family.
